I'm facing the following problem:

One Win2k3 client with 3 different jobs. Since neither the network link
nor the cpu and io on the client machine are saturated I wanted to run
this three jobs concurrently. This would effectively triple the backup
speed.

This works, the director reports all three jobs running as the the fd
on the client machine does.

The problem is, only the first job transfers data, the two other jobs
are just sitting around, doing nothing (at least nothing obvious). So I
wonder if this is intended behaviour or a misconfiguration/bug.

I tested with both 2.0.3 and 2.2.8 windows clients backing up to 2.0.3
FreeBSD director/storage daemon. I tested with VSS turned of also.

Actually with this behaviour the "Maximum Concurrent Jobs" directives
in the "FileDaemon" resource of the client file daemon and the "Client"
resource of the director does not make much sense. If I configure 3
concurrent jobs on a client I would expect them all to transfer data.

If anyone has a clue what's going on I would appreciate any feedback.
I would also be grateful if someone could hint me how to achieve what
I intended by other means.
